The viewership figure and demo rating for Tuesday’s (September 26) edition of WWE NXT on USA Network has been revealed.

Per Brandon Thurston of Wrestlenomics, NXT drew 636,000 viewers. This is down from the September 19 edition that drew 824,000 viewers.

In the 18-49 demographic, Tuesday’s show scored 0.18 rating. This is also down from the week prior that scored 0.24 rating.

The show featured Butch defeating Joe Coffey to win the NXT Global Heritage Invitational Tournament and move on to face Noam Dar for the NXT Heritage Cup this Saturday at No Mercy.

Also, Trick Williams defeated Joe Gacy, and then went on to defeat Axiom, Tyler Bate and Dragon Lee to become the number one contender for Dominik Mysterio’s NXT North American Championship at No Mercy.
